Warhog Posted October 13, 2020 Posted October 13, 2020 How many motors do you want to drive? With exception of the EMI on the A10C, I am driving that same stepper motor right from a pro mini. Very smooth and its based off the Arduino library by Guy Carpenter. No driver board is necessary. Each motor takes four GPIO pins but if you only run a couple of motors from a single Nano or Pro Mini, then who cares. If your set on using a driver board, look at the Easy Driver board... http://www.schmalzhaus.com/EasyDriver/Examples/EasyDriverExamples.html Regards John W aka WarHog. My Cockpit Build Pictures... CorporalCarrot Posted December 3, 2020 Posted December 3, 2020 I've driven both X27.168 and VID28-05 steppers directly from Nano's and Mega's. I use the Accelstepper.h library, as it is one of the most comprehensive library's, but you have to be careful not to overload the processor. The library is quite heavy on the processor to calculate the steps using an acceleration curve, so If you drive more than one stepper motor from the same Arduino at the same time, the processor can get overloaded. I have found driving 2 steppers from a single nano works reasonably well, but anymore and they won't accelerate properly. I have been toying with using an M0 based arduino board, or and Arduino Due M3 based board, which run at 48MHz and 84MHz respectively (compared with 8MHz for the Nano - not withstanding 32bit CPU speed boost vs. the ATMega328 8-bit chip). I would expect these to be able to run several steppers, but I'm not sure how compatible the Arduino Due is with DCSBios...
